The Music Man TCM, 11 a.m.

In this delightful Academy Award-winning 1962 film adaptation of the Broadway musical, airing as part of TCM’S “Musical Matinee” series, a charismati­c con man (Robert Preston) masquerade­s as a band instructor to swindle the locals into paying him to create a boys’ marching band. Shirley Jones co-stars as the town librarian and piano instructor who wins his heart and eventually convinces the townspeopl­e to forgive him. Also co-stars Buddy Hackett, Hermione Gingold, Paul Ford and Ron Howard.

robbie the reindeer CBS, 7 p.m.

CBS airs two “Robbie the Reindeer” animated holiday specials, beginning with “Hooves of Fire,” in which Robbie (voice of Ben Stiller) competes against Blitzen (voice of Hugh Grant) in the Reindeer Races for a position on Santa’s sleigh team. Then in “Legend of the Lost Tribe,” Robbie must stop Blitzen from creating a Reindeer World theme park.

sventoonie christmas special

METV, 9 p.m.

Following “Svengoolie’s” presentati­on of the 1935 Poe-inspired Bela Lugosi-boris Karloff classic “The Raven,” which starts in the show’s usual time slot two hours earlier, this follow-up special holiday installmen­t of spinoff series “Sventoonie” features the 1950 comedy film “The Great Rupert,” which stars Jimmy Durante alongside the titular animated squirrel.
